Introduction

A dosing system is crucial for accurately measuring and introducing specific amounts of a substance into a process or application. These systems are essential in various industries, ensuring precise control over chemical, fluid, or other product delivery. The accuracy and efficiency of dosing systems can significantly impact production, quality, and safety.

Applications of Dosing Systems

Dosing systems are employed across numerous sectors, including water treatment, pharmaceuticals, food and beverage production, and chemical processing. Each application demands specific dosing accuracy and control:

  • Water Treatment: Used for chlorination and pH adjustment.
  • Pharmaceuticals: Ensures precise drug formulation and compounding.
  • Food and Beverage: Adds flavorings, colorings, or preservatives accurately.
  • Chemical Industry: Controls reaction efficiency and product quality.

Key Components of Dosing Systems

A typical dosing system includes several core components, each with specific roles:

  • Pumps: Integral for moving fluids; types include diaphragm, peristaltic, and piston pumps.
  • Control Units: Manage dosing schedules, flow rates, and system alerts.
  • Measurement Devices: Ensure accuracy by measuring flow rates and volumes.
  • Valves and Tubing: Facilitate the controlled flow and distribution of substances.

Technical Specifications and Parameters

Dosing systems are designed to meet precise technical parameters to ensure optimal performance:

  • Flow Rate Range: 0.1 - 10,000 liters per hour (l/h).
  • Accuracy: Within ±1% of the set point.
  • Pressure Range: 0 - 20 bar, depending on pump type.
  • Temperature Range: Operates between -10°C and 60°C.

These parameters are critical for selecting the right dosing system for specific industrial applications, ensuring that performance meets safety and regulatory standards.
